Burley Auction Gallery is proud to offer at auction, The Donald & Louise Yena Saloon, Gambling, & Texas Lawman Collection. Featuring legendary Texas Ranger Captain Frank Jones' fully documented Winchester & presentation pocket watch, & Ranger badge that were most recently on display at the Texas Ranger Museum by special request. Plus Historic Texas Ranger Firearms & Relics, A Large collection of Texas lawman badges, Texas Ranger badges, U.S. Marshal badges, historic guns, & more. Texas Saloon & gambling items, Texas Saloon trade tokens, Gambler's cheating devices, Texas Saloon jugs, early Texas Lone Star & Pearl beer items, Spurs, Original Donald Yena Oil Paintings & more! From the collection of famed San Antonio Texas Western Artist Donald Yena. More photos & details coming soon.
